How to build reinforcement learning environment?

Hi all!
I’m currently learning reinforcement learning and I would like to build my custom environment but I don’t know how should I build it.
I want to build warehouse environment with 10 x 10 grid and in a grid there is an item in specific location which my agent should pick up and move to destination (0, 0 in a grid), destination is the starting point of an agent.
How should I make states when agent picks item and carries it?

